MrRodgers -> RE: GROW UP AMERICA (9/9/2016 5:37:29 AM)


quote:

ORIGINAL: LadyDemura

Ban guns, ban region, ban states rights! The Constitution was a more perfect document without this so called Bill of Rights. A bunch of stupid southerners insisted on it back then, and look what we have now...a bunch of stupid southerners defending it...

You cannot possibly be serious. First of all, there were as many northerners demanding a BOR as there was southerners. Chief among those was the Massachusetts convention was angry and contentious and even broke into a fight. Anti-Federalists Samuel Adams and John Hancock agreed to ratification (of the constitution and only) on the condition that the convention also propose amendments to it.

Ben Franklin form PA. insisted on a BOR. Yes, the BOR and in particular the 10th amend. has been eviscerated by the courts using the commerce clause and the 14th amend. which has given the federal govt. much more power than was originally intended.

MrRodgers -> RE: GROW UP AMERICA (9/9/2016 11:43:06 AM)

Part of the problem is that the courts have ruled both in favor of states rights when it suits them and against states rights too.

United States v. Lopez, No. 93-1260, declared a federal creation of 'Gun Free Zones' unconstitutional in violation of states rights.

HERE

Gonzales v. Raich (previously Ashcroft v. Raich), 545 U.S. 1 (2005), was a decision by the US Supreme Court ruling that under the Commerce Clause of the US Constitution, Congress may criminalize the production and use of homegrown cannabis even if states approve its use for medicinal purposes.

HERE

The court told the world flat out that the commerce clause comes in very handy when you need it and the 10th amend....be damned.
